Sonar Software Alternatives for ISP Billing and Subscriber Management
For a residential ISP with conventional plans, staying on a purpose built subscriber platform is almost always the right call, and swapping to a competitor only helps if a specific feature gap is blocking you. Build when your commercial model is the product: a focused subscriber and billing build runs $60k to $150k in 12 to 18 weeks, and a full platform with provisioning and portals runs $180k to $400k. Do not build if you have under a few thousand subscribers, no engineers on staff, or standard monthly plans.
Why ISPs start looking for a Sonar alternative
Three complaints send operators to this page, and they are not the same problem wearing different clothes.
The first is the shape of a deal the platform will not model. You sign a bulk internet agreement with an apartment building: the property pays a per unit rate, residents get service included, some units upgrade individually, the property manager wants one invoice with a unit level breakdown, and there is a revenue share back to the owner. That is one contract with four billing behaviours, and it does not fit neatly into an account and service model designed around a household paying for its own connection. Somebody ends up maintaining a spreadsheet next to the billing system, and the spreadsheet is what finance actually trusts.
The second is cost per subscriber. Platforms in this category commonly price against active accounts, which means the software bill rises exactly in step with the growth you are working for. At two thousand subscribers that is a reasonable trade for not running billing yourself. At twenty thousand, with thin residential margins, it becomes a number the board asks about.
The third is the seam between billing and the network. Your provisioning stack, your inventory, your field crews and your monitoring all have to agree with the billing system about what a customer has. When they disagree, someone is either being billed for a service they do not have or receiving one they do not pay for, and both are discovered late.
What Sonar genuinely does well
Give it credit for the thing that matters most: it is built for internet service providers rather than adapted for them. Generic subscription tools have no concept of an IP assignment, a service address, an equipment serial number attached to a customer, or a network wide event that should suppress a thousand individual alerts. Sonar treats those as first class facts because that is the market it serves.
The cloud hosted model is also a genuine advantage that operators underrate until they have lived without it. Running your own authentication servers, database and billing jobs sounds cheap until a Sunday night failure means nobody can authenticate onto the network. A hosted platform moves that class of risk to someone whose whole job it is, and it ships changes continuously without you scheduling upgrade weekends.
If you are a residential ISP with conventional plans, a support desk, and no software engineers, this is a category where buying beats building by a wide margin. That is not a hedge, it is the honest recommendation for most readers.
Where it strains
- Commercial model ceilings. Bulk agreements, wholesale arrangements, open access networks, revenue share and complex proration are where configuration screens run out of room.
- Per subscriber economics at scale. The cost curve tracks growth, so success is what makes the line item uncomfortable.
- Integration with your own systems. If you have built field tooling, a custom portal or unusual provisioning automation, you are maintaining both ends of every seam.
- Reporting shapes. Property managers, wholesale partners and investors all want different cuts of the same subscriber data, and standard reporting rarely covers all three.
- Data portability. Subscriber history, usage records and billing history are your commercial memory. Confirm how completely you can extract them before you need to.
- Release cadence you do not control. Continuous updates are mostly a benefit, until a change alters a workflow your support team relies on and you had no say in the timing.
Your real options
Staying is the baseline. If none of the strains above describe an actual weekly cost to your business, the correct answer is to stop reading comparison pages and go sell connections.
Switching platforms is a real option and the field is reasonably deep. Splynx appeals to operators who want self hosting and heavy network automation, Powercode and Azotel have long histories with wireless operators, Visp serves smaller providers, Rev.io reaches further into telecom billing and tax, and UISP suits very small networks built on one vendor's equipment. Each solves a slightly different flavour of the problem. Switching is worth it when there is one specific capability you need that your current platform does not have and will not have. It is not worth it when the underlying complaint is per subscriber pricing, because you are usually swapping one variant of that model for another.
Building is the third path, and the smart version is partial. Keep a platform for the ordinary residential base and build the layer that handles the deals that do not fit. Or keep the billing engine and build the customer portal, the property manager portal and the reporting yourself.
When a custom build pays back
Build when your commercial model is your differentiation. Open access network operators, wholesale providers and bulk multi dwelling specialists all sell something structurally different from a monthly residential plan, and the billing logic is the business rather than an administrative afterthought. If your sales team is inventing deal structures faster than the platform can express them, that is the signal.
Build when you are large enough that a fraction of a percent of billing accuracy is worth more than the whole project. At scale, small errors in proration, plan changes and equipment charges add up to real money, and owning the logic means you can test it, audit it and fix it on your schedule.
Build when provisioning automation is a competitive advantage. If you can activate a service in minutes because your systems talk to each other properly, that shows up in installation throughput and in churn, and it depends on you controlling both ends.
Build when acquisitions are your growth model. Buying small networks means inheriting their plans, their promises and their billing habits, and a platform that cannot express a legacy tariff leaves you two options: migrate every acquired customer onto your plans, which causes churn at the worst possible moment, or run a second system alongside the first. Owning the model lets you carry the odd plans quietly until they age out on their own.
Migration reality, and the part everyone forgets
Subscriber migration has one genuinely hard element that catches teams out: stored payment credentials. Card details live with your payment gateway as tokens, and those tokens are usually tied to the merchant and gateway configuration rather than being portable at will. Moving billing systems can mean coordinating a token migration with your gateway, or in the worst case asking thousands of customers to re enter their card details, which is a churn event dressed as an IT project. Establish exactly what is possible with your gateway before you commit to anything else.
Beyond that, the sequence is familiar and non negotiable. Export subscribers, service plans, addresses, equipment assignments, balances, tax configuration and full invoice history. Load into the new system. Run one complete billing cycle in parallel, generate invoices in both systems, and reconcile every account before a single real invoice goes out. Cut authentication and provisioning over separately from billing, because doing both at once means an outage and a billing dispute arrive on the same day. Budget a fortnight of reduced support throughput while your desk learns new screens.
Cost bands and the verdict
Subscriber platforms are typically priced per active account per month, so model your cost at the subscriber count you expect in three years, not today. On the build side, a focused subscriber and billing system covering accounts, services, invoicing, payments and the deal structures you actually sell runs roughly $60k to $150k over 12 to 18 weeks in our delivery experience. A fuller platform adding provisioning automation, customer and property manager portals, field workflow and network integration runs roughly $180k to $400k.
The verdict: stay if you are a residential ISP with standard plans, because this is genuinely a solved problem and your engineering effort belongs in the network. Switch if there is a named capability you need and cannot get, and go in knowing the pricing model travels with you. Build when your deal structures are the business, when scale makes billing accuracy financially material, or when provisioning speed is how you compete. And consider the hybrid before the full rebuild, because keeping a platform for the simple base while owning the complicated edge is cheaper than either extreme. Whichever way you go, model software cost per subscriber against your average revenue per user at the scale you expect in three years, since that one ratio predicts how you will feel about this decision later.
